Filing 43 ORDER GRANTING ORDER GRANTING STIPULATION FOR: (1) DISCHARGE OF PRIMERICA; (2) PERMANENT INJUNCTION; (3) REIMBURSEMENT OF REASONABLE ATTORNEYS FEES AND COSTS; (4) DISTRIBUTION OF POLICY BENEFIT; AND (5) DISMISSAL WITH PREJUDICE 42 by Judge Percy An derson: That Defendants-In-Interpleader Jose Cisneros, Jesse Volanos Ramirez, Karina L. Cisneros and TMC and their respective agents, attorneys and/or assigns are enjoined and perpetually restrained re the Policy. That Primerica is awarded the sum of $7,000 as its reasonable attorneys fees and costs incurred in this action, to be deducted from the Policy benefit deposited with the Court, to be made payable via a check to Primerica Life Insurance Company.That counsel for TMC is awarded the sum $2,325 as her reasonable attorneys fees incurred in this action, to be deducted from the Policy benefit deposited with the Court. (Made JS-6. Case Terminated.) (lc) |
